
The LTX-2 Text to Video (Distilled) workflow is designed to transform text prompts into high-quality videos with synchronized audio and video elements. Utilizing the LTX-2 distilled model, this workflow is optimized for faster video generation while maintaining a high level of quality. It features expressive lip sync and dynamic motion generation, making it ideal for creating engaging video content. The workflow employs nodes like SaveVideo and 9b0e709c-82c7-46c0-a2e4-5e96b6f16090, which are crucial for processing and rendering the final video output. The LTX-2 model, developed by Lightricks, is accessible via Huggingface and GitHub, providing a robust foundation for this workflow.

Every Comfy workflow is a JSON graph. The payload below is this workflow, exactly as ComfyUI runs it — fetch it from the URL, keep it in version control, or load it in ComfyUI and run it node by node.
Run it from TypeScript or Python with the Comfy SDK. The same code targets Comfy Cloud or a ComfyUI you host yourself — only the base URL changes.
